Sewage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sewage spill in a bathroom |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but be sure to follow safety protocols and take necessary precautions. |
| Backed-up toilet or drain | No | Yes | Backed-up toilets and drains need immediate attention to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Visible water damage on walls or floors | No | Yes | Visible water damage needs prompt attention to prevent mold growth and further damage. |
| Sewage backup or overflow | No | Yes | Sewage backup or overflow needs immediate attention to prevent health risks and further damage. |
| Large sewage spill in a basement | No | Yes | Large sewage spills need professional equipment and expertise to safely and effectively clean up. |
| Unpleasant odors or moisture in a crawlspace or attic | No | Yes | Moisture in your crawlspace or attic can be a sign of hidden damage, including mold growth and structural issues. |

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Lugoff, SC
The cost of sewage water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lugoff, SC.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sewage water extraction services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small sewage spill cleanup |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Backed-up toilet or drain service |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
| Visible water damage rep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ed |
| Sewage backup or overflow cleanup | $5,000 – $20,000 | Sever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
| Large sewage spill cleanup | $10,000 – $50,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Moisture remediation in a crawlspace or attic |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
